What Is Bone Thickness?
Bone thickness refers to the amount of mineral material in your bones, specifically calcium and phosphorus, which establishes their toughness and framework. Healthy bone thickness is critical for total bone wellness, as it assists protect against cracks and supports your body's numerous functions. When your bone thickness is optimum, your bones can withstand day-to-day stresses and pressures without breaking.
As you age, your bone thickness naturally reduces, particularly in women post-menopause. This decline can lead to problems like weakening of bones, making bones much more fragile and vulnerable to injury.
To preserve or enhance your bone density, you've reached take notice of your way of life choices. Normal weight-bearing workouts, a balanced diet regimen rich in calcium and vitamin D, and avoiding smoking cigarettes and excessive alcohol consumption can all contribute substantially.

Impact on Oral Implants
Sufficient bone density is essential for the success of oral implants. When you undertake a dental implant treatment, the implant requirements to integrate with your jawbone, giving stability and strength. If your bone density is insufficient, the implant might not fuse correctly, leading to issues like implant failing. You desire a tough structure for your implant, and low bone thickness can compromise that.
Poor bone density can likewise impact the positioning of the implant. If the bone isn't thick sufficient to sustain the dental implant, your dentist may need to place it in a much less ideal placement, which can result in misalignment and discomfort. This can impact your capability to chew and speak effectively.
In addition, low bone thickness can enhance the danger of infection around the dental implant website. Without solid bone support, the body may battle to heal properly, and that can result in problems better down the line.
Inevitably, guaranteeing you have adequate bone thickness not only improves the instant success of your oral implant but also enhances your lasting dental health and capability. Solutions for Low Bone Density
If you're dealing with reduced bone thickness and taking into consideration dental implants, there are several efficient options to discover.
First, your dental professional could suggest bone grafting, where they make use of bone product from an additional part of your body or a contributor to rebuild the bone structure in your jaw. This treatment can create a more powerful structure for your implants.
An additional alternative is the use of dental implants particularly designed for reduced bone density. Mini oral implants are smaller sized in size and call for less bone, making them a great option if your bone thickness is endangered.
You might additionally consider the opportunity of using development aspects or bone-stimulating medications. These therapies can urge your body to regrow bone cells and boost thickness over time.
Lastly, way of life changes-- like boosted calcium and vitamin D consumption, regular workout, and giving up smoking cigarettes-- can also strengthen your bones.
